Aeropuertos Argentina bonds rise in first day of trading

Aeropuertos Argentina 2000 SA sold USD300 million of 10-year debt on 16-Dec-2010 after recently increasing the size of the offering (Bloomberg, 17-Dec-2010). The company's 10.75% senior secured notes rose USD4.5 cents on the dollar as of 14:22 since they were issued at par, according the bond-price reporting system of the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ority, Trace.
